1. The Birth of a Legend: How Supreme Became a Cultural Icon
Founded in 1994 by James Jebbia, Supreme started as a small skate shop on Lafayette Street in SoHo, New York City. Initially, it was just another spot for skaters to grab gear and hang out. However, its unique approach to branding, combining streetwear with skate culture, quickly set it apart. By the late ’90s, Supreme was already making waves, collaborating with brands like The North Face and releasing limited-edition items that sparked frenzied buying sprees. The brand’s exclusivity and hype became its hallmark, and before long, Supreme was more than just a clothing line—it was a movement. 🛹🌟
2. Supreme’s Place in the Fashion Hierarchy: Luxury Meets Street
Fast forward to today, and Supreme has cemented itself as a luxury brand, albeit one with roots firmly planted in the streets. Its collaborations with high-fashion houses like Louis Vuitton and its frequent appearances on runways have blurred the lines between streetwear and haute couture. Yet, despite its upscale positioning, Supreme remains deeply connected to its urban origins. This duality is what makes it so intriguing—Supreme is both a symbol of elite fashion and a beacon of street credibility. 💎👟
3. The Supreme Experience: From Drops to Resale Mania
One of the most defining aspects of Supreme is its drop culture. Every week, the brand releases new products, often in limited quantities, creating a frenzy among fans who camp out for hours to secure the latest items. This ritual has transformed Supreme into a global phenomenon, with resale values soaring and counterfeit goods flooding the market. For many, owning a piece of Supreme isn’t just about fashion—it’s about status and belonging to a community that shares a passion for the brand. 🕒💸
